Reboot Windows once the driver is uninstalled and Windows will install a new one.Ĭheck to see if the latest Windows update is installed, update your Windows if needed Follow steps from point 3 to get to the driver in Device Manager, then right-click on it but instead of update choose to uninstall. If driver update failed or you already have the latest drivers, reinstalling them could fix the issue since drivers might have corrupted during installation of some update or application. Right-click on it and choose update driver. If you have a driver device error inside Windows, you should see it immediately when entering the Device Manager, it will have a yellow exclamation mark beside it. Once it opens, click on Device Manager to open it, In order to check to see if the driver is properly working press ⊞ WINDOWS + X to open the hidden start menu. In any case, the Device Manager will be the one who will report this problem. If both hardware is functioning properly and volume control in Windows is set correctly then the issue might be in Windows not detecting device or driver malfunction.
